What is the reason behind breast cancer? Let me explain.
A woman can get breast cancer if her family has a history of cancer.
This is genetic cancer, and some other factors like not eating good foods, no physical exercise, and smoking or alcohol are also triggers for breast cancer.
There are some ways to prevent these cancers.
1. Keep Weight in Check: Being overweight can increase the risk of many different cancers, including breast cancer, especially for women getting older.
2. Be physically active. Regular exercise is one of the best things for your health. Try to get at least 30 minutes a day, but any amount of physical activity is better than none.
3. Eat Fruits and Vegetables: Try to eat a lot of fruits and vegetables and limit alcohol. if Alcohol Zero is Best.
4. Don’t Smoke: Smoking causes at least 15 different cancers, including breast cancer. If you smoke, try to quit as soon as possible.
5. Breastfeed, If Possible: Breastfeeding for a total of one year or more lowers the risk of
breast cancer. It also has great health benefits for the child.
6. Avoid birth control pills, particularly after age 35 or if you smoke, while women are taking birth control pills, they have a slightly increased risk of breast cancer.
7.Check your breasts regularly; keep two fingers on your breasts; and check if you have any pain or find any hard or rounded. Please consult with your doctors.
